2006 CONCACAF Women's Gold Cup

The 2006 CONCACAF Women's Gold Cup was the third edition of the CONCACAF Women's Gold Cup, and also acted as a qualifier tournament for the 2007 FIFA Women's World Cup. The tournament finals took place in the United States of America between 19 November and 27 November 2006. The USA and Canada received byes into the tournament after contesting the final of the 2002 Gold Cup, while four other spots were determined through regional qualification.
